Indiana University's 60th Summer Workshop in Slavic, East European, and
Central Asian Languages 

June 18th - August 13th, 2010

Bloomington, Indiana

 

ALL participants pay IN-STATE TUITION. Foreign Language Area Studies
Awards and Title VIII funding is available. The following languages are
ACLS-funded and TUITION-FREE for graduate students studying in the
East/Central European area are: Bosnian/Croatian/Serbian, Macedonian,
Polish, and Romanian.

Deadline for the first round of fellowship awards is March 22, 2010.
Acceptance and fellowships are determined on a space-available basis after
that date.

 

The following languages will be offered:

Russian (1st through 6th years)                           
                                                         

Azerbaijani (1st & 2nd)

Bosnian/Croatian/Serbian (1st)                                 

Czech (1st)

Georgian (1st)

Hungarian (1st)

Kazakh (1st & 2nd)                                                  

Macedonian (1st)

Mongolian (1st)

Pashto (1st and 2nd)

Polish (1st)

Romanian (1st)

Tajik (1st through 3rd)

Turkmen (1st & 2nd)

Ukrainian (2nd)

Uyghur (1st through 3rd)

Uzbek (1st & 2nd)
